The Good Things Book Club invites avid readers to the St. Charles Parish West Regional Library in Luling for an engaging monthly discussion. Meeting on the last Wednesday of each month, this group provides a welcoming space for literature enthusiasts to share their thoughts and perspectives. The June session features the theme 'Summer Escape,' encouraging participants to read any book centered around a journey or trip. It is a perfect opportunity to connect with fellow readers.
